I have lived at the Villas Parkmerced for a year and a half now. Up until yesterday I thought that the good and the bad of living here were equal. I have a beautiful apartment with a view of a beautiful golf course and beyond that the ocean. It's just outside of the city (even though it's still in sf) and it is right next to SF state, so it is very convenient for my boyfriend to get to class. Another thing is that it has easy access to the MUNI, which I ride to work. The bad things about the apartment I was living with - The middle of the night noise of the college kids in the building, the lack of convenient parking, the colder weather, and the very slow apartment staff that never returns your call and when they do they still don't know the answer to your question. The problem here is that just yesterday when I got back from vacation I had an eviction notice on my front door!!! I always pay my rent ontime and in full - so you can imagine my surprise. Well after I left 3 messages for the apartment staff and finally got a hold of someone in a different office to tell them to take off of their call forwarding - I finally got a hold of someone that could help me. Come to find out that they were recording the rent for my apartment for another apartment for the past 3 months!!! It has now been over 24 hours and the apartment staff still hasn't settled this with me. Everytime I call to check back on the status of fixing my account the guy in the leasing office had no idea who I was! No customer service skills at all!! The staff also never calls me back when they say they will. If you are fooled into thinking that this is a good place to live you are wrong! After this experience I will never again be fooled into thinking that it is better to live in a corporate owned apartment complex. The bad outweighs the good! <P>
